That particular error is a pesky one. It's nothing on this side (if it was there wouldn't be hundreds of people in chat right now), the most common reason is a weak or intermittent connection, but it is hard to pin it down. You could try uninstalling flash completely (using the flash uninstaller from the adobe site) reboot your pc and then install a fresh copy. Sometimes something will get corrupted during an update so it's worth a try.
